Few people know this, but toilet paper was only invented about 200 years ago. Still, today, it’s a household essential. We use a lot of toilet paper, considering more than seven billion rolls of it are sold every year in the United States alone.

Well, as it turns out, there are actually plenty of creative ways to reuse them and give them new purpose so that you can save both time and money. For instance, did you know that you can create a cool pencil holder using an empty roll, some glue and some colored paper?
That’s right; instead of buying this desk essential, why not save a couple of bucks and make your own? All the instructions are provided in the video below.
Another cool way to reuse empty toilet paper rolls is to make your own iPhone holder. You’ll only need a pair of scissors to do this – and you don’t even have to be super crafty! Just a few cuts, and your DIY phone older will be ready to use!
